English Language Learning Vehicle227
The English language learning vehicle is a powerful tool which can be used to gain proficiency in the English language. There are many different types of English language learning vehicles available, each with its own unique advantages and disadvantages. One popular type of language learning vehicle is the textbook. Textbooks provide a structured approach to learning a language, with lessons that are carefully sequenced and organized. Textbooks often include exercises and activities that help learners practice their new knowledge and skills.
Another type of language learning vehicle is the online course. Online courses offer the flexibility to learn at your own pace and on your own time. They often include interactive exercises and activities, and some courses even offer live video instruction. Online courses can be a great option for people who have busy schedules or who live in remote areas.
If you are looking for a more personalized learning experience, you may want to consider hiring a private tutor. Private tutors can provide individualized instruction and support, and they can help you focus on the areas where you need the most help. Private tutoring can be a great option for people who are preparing for a language exam or who want to quickly improve their language skills.
There are also many other types of English language learning vehicles available, such as language learning software, apps, and podcasts. The best way to find the right language learning vehicle for you is to try out a few different options and see what works best for you. Learning a language takes time and effort, but with the right language learning vehicle, you can reach your goals.
Here are some tips for choosing the right English language learning vehicle:
Consider your learning style. Are you a visual learner, an auditory learner, or a kinesthetic learner? Choose a language learning vehicle that matches your learning style.
Think about your goals. Are you learning English for travel, for work, or for academic purposes? Choose a language learning vehicle that will help you reach your goals.
Set a budget. How much money are you willing to spend on language learning? There are many affordable language learning vehicles available, but there are also some more expensive options.
Do your research. Read reviews of different language learning vehicles before you make a decision. Talk to other language learners to get their recommendations.
Once you have chosen a language learning vehicle, stick with it. Learning a language takes time and effort, but with consistency and dedication, you will reach your goals.
